Item 8.01 Other Events.
On March 8, 2018, the Public Utility Commission of Texas (the “PUCT”) approved and executed a Final Order (the “Order”) approving the Joint Report and Application of Oncor Electric Delivery Company LLC and Sempra Energy for Regulatory Approvals Pursuant to PURA §§ 14.101, 39.262 and 39.915 (the “Joint Application”) that was filed with the PUCT on October 5, 2017. The Order is consistent with the terms of the stipulation agreed to by all of the key stakeholders in the proceeding regarding the Joint Application as described in Sempra Energy’s Current Report on Form 8-K fil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on December 15, 2017 and attached as Exhibit 99.1 thereto. The Order represents the last regulatory approval necessary for Sempra Energy to complete the merger of Energy Future Holdings Corp., a Texas corporation, with an indirect, wholly owned subsidiary of Sempra Energy, a California corporation, whereby Sempra Energy will acquire an 80.03% indirect interest in Oncor Electric Delivery Company LLC.
